Sorry for the questions of a newbie, but:<br>
<p>
<p>
I seem not to be able to access my scanner under Linux<br>
<p>
my setup:<br>
i486, 32 mb ram, ...., ncr810 controller, umax Astra 600, sane 0.66<br>
linux 1.0.25<br>
<p>
I compiled my kernel with Generic SCSI support, at start the message pops<br>
up<br>
<p>
detected SCSI generic sge at scsi0, channel 0, id 6, lun 0<br>
<p>
I created a device node for the scanner<br>
<p>
mknod -m 660 /dev/sge c 21 6<br>
<p>
my /dev lokks like <br>
<p>
....<br>
lrwxrwxrwx 1 root root 8 Oct 29 21:12 /dev/scanner -&gt;<br>
/dev/sge<br>
crw-rw---- 1 root root 21, 6 Oct 29 21:12 /dev/sge<br>
....<br>
<p>
My umax.conf looks like<br>
<p>
/dev/scanner<br>
# this is a comment<br>
/dev/sge<br>
<p>
All seems ok, but if I start scanimage, my scanner isn't available<br>
<p>
# (/dev/scanner)?<br>
sanei_scsi_open: open() failed: No such device or address<br>
# (/dev/sge)?<br>
sanei_scsi_open: open() failed: No such device or address<br>
# (/dev/sge)?<br>
sanei_scsi_open: open() failed: No such device or address<br>
<p>
(the # lines are some own debug code, because somehow the sanei code don't<br>
bring debug code). Yes I set SANE_DEBUG_UMAX and SANE_SANEI_SCSI (or the<br>
equivalent thing from "man sane-config" to 128)<br>
<p>
Looks like I missed something important but what?<br>
